A meeting was held with the leadership of Kazakhstan's "Halyk Bank"
2025-02-27 18:00:00 / News of ministry

For reference: "Halyk Bank" is part of the "Halyk" group, which operates in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an, Russia, Georgia, Tajikistan, and Uzbekistan, and engages in banking, insurance, brokerage, and leasing activities.
The meeting discussed prospects for developing economic cooperation between Uzbekistan and Kazakhstan. Special attention was given to deepening cooperation in the banking sector, expanding investment collaboration, and supporting business activities.
The main topics of discussion were:
- Development of the investment potential of Tenge Bank
The leadership of "Halyk Bank" provided information on the bank's investment activities in 2024 and its financial performance.
- Supporting entrepreneurship
Mechanisms for supporting entrepreneurs, including attracting investments and introducing new methods to create conditions for sustainable economic growth, were discussed. Special attention was given to mechanisms such as digital loans for individual entrepreneurs and online onboarding for businesses.
At the end of the meeting, the parties expressed their interest in further strengthening bilateral cooperation and implementing joint projects that will contribute to the development of the economies of both countries.
